    Glen Ord 9 Year Old 2011 (casks 313939, 313519 & 313524) - Small Batch (James Eadie)

    Fabulous Highland single malt from the Glen Ord Distillery, independently bottled by James Eadie as part of its Small Batch series. Distilled in 2011, this was matured for nine years in ex-bourbon casks, before bottling in 2021. The bottle has a nice acorn illustration on the label, inspired by The Acorn pub, which was owned by James Eadie in the 1800s.

    Tasting Note by The Chaps at Master of Malt

    Nose

    Floral heather and blossom, charred wood.

    Palate

    Flaky, buttery apple pastry, sweet honey roasted nuts, and dried petals and just a dash of pepper spice.

    Finish

    Crisp fresh apples and pears, creamy, mouth coating texture with lingering sweet malt and gentle oak spice.
